我一直在尝试使用encrypt加密字符串将其发送到网络服务器,但我不断收到错误。这是我的职能:voidencRypt(Stringda){finalkey="my32lengthsupersecretnooneknows1";finalencrypter=newEncrypter(newAES(key));finalencrypted=encrypter.encrypt(da);print(encrypted);}这就是我使用函数的方式:encRypt(chatBody.text);而chatBody是一个TextEditingControllerthemainerrors这是我的调试
我一直在尝试使用encrypt加密字符串将其发送到网络服务器,但我不断收到错误。这是我的职能:voidencRypt(Stringda){finalkey="my32lengthsupersecretnooneknows1";finalencrypter=newEncrypter(newAES(key));finalencrypted=encrypter.encrypt(da);print(encrypted);}这就是我使用函数的方式:encRypt(chatBody.text);而chatBody是一个TextEditingControllerthemainerrors这是我的调试
HTTPS采用的是对称加密和非对称加密结合的「混合加密」方式:在通信建立前采用非对称加密的方式交换「会话秘钥」,后续就不再使用非对称加密。在通信过程中全部使用对称加密的「会话秘钥」的方式加密明文数据。采用「混合加密」的方式的原因:对称加密只使用一个密钥,运算速度快,密钥必须保密,无法做到安全的密钥交换。非对称加密使用两个密钥:公钥和私钥,公钥可以任意分发而私钥保密,解决了密钥交换问题但速度慢。HTTPS 是如何建立连接的?SSL/TLS协议基本流程:客户端向服务器索要并验证服务器的公钥。双方协商生产「会话秘钥」。双方采用「会话秘钥」进行加密通信。前两步也就是SSL/TLS的建立过程,也就是握手
文章目录ECC算法椭圆曲线椭圆曲线的二元运算关于阿贝尔群(abeliangroup)椭圆曲线中的阿贝尔群椭圆曲线加密算法原理ECC算法椭圆曲线ECC是椭圆曲线加密算法,WolframMathWorld(线上数学百科全书,http://mathworld.wolfram.com)给出了非常精准的定义:一条椭圆曲线就是一组被y2=x3+ax+by^2=x^3+ax+by2=x3+ax+b定义的且满足4a3+27b2≠04a^3+27b^2≠04a3+27b2=0的点集。4a3+27b2≠04a^3+27b^2≠04a3+27b2=0这个限定条件是为了保证曲线不包含奇点(在数学中是指曲线上任意一
文章目录ECC算法椭圆曲线椭圆曲线的二元运算关于阿贝尔群(abeliangroup)椭圆曲线中的阿贝尔群椭圆曲线加密算法原理ECC算法椭圆曲线ECC是椭圆曲线加密算法,WolframMathWorld(线上数学百科全书,http://mathworld.wolfram.com)给出了非常精准的定义:一条椭圆曲线就是一组被y2=x3+ax+by^2=x^3+ax+by2=x3+ax+b定义的且满足4a3+27b2≠04a^3+27b^2≠04a3+27b2=0的点集。4a3+27b2≠04a^3+27b^2≠04a3+27b2=0这个限定条件是为了保证曲线不包含奇点(在数学中是指曲线上任意一
1.资源直接解包当使用unity自带的加密算法进行assetBundle加密时,可使用AssetStudio直接进行解密。优点:可直接解出资源所有数据,包括模型的蒙皮骨骼,变形器信息都会包含在里面缺点:简单二次加密即不可破解2.代码逆向使用IL2CPPDumper可对unity生成的代码进行逆向操作,从而看到开发者的原始代码优点:可直接逆向开发者的源代码缺点:1)代码已打碎,需根据内存地址逐个逆向函数内容。2)自行加密即不可破解3.相关加密1)资源:AssetBundle偏移加密2)资源:AssetBudnle二进制混淆加密/随机数加密等3)代码:直接在unityEditor下对原始的c++加
我正在使用FMDB来处理sqlite,我希望避免对SQLCipher的依赖。我怎样才能简单地利用iOS内置的DataProtection功能?这是否可能-唯一的要求是在手机被盗时保护数据。如果手机使用PIN解锁,则用户可以访问数据库-这是他们的数据。 最佳答案 查找您执行databaseWithPath:(或initWithPath:)的行,然后添加:FMDatabase*db=[FMDatabasedatabaseWithPath:path];NSDictionary*attributes=@{NSFileProtection
我正在使用FMDB来处理sqlite,我希望避免对SQLCipher的依赖。我怎样才能简单地利用iOS内置的DataProtection功能?这是否可能-唯一的要求是在手机被盗时保护数据。如果手机使用PIN解锁,则用户可以访问数据库-这是他们的数据。 最佳答案 查找您执行databaseWithPath:(或initWithPath:)的行,然后添加:FMDatabase*db=[FMDatabasedatabaseWithPath:path];NSDictionary*attributes=@{NSFileProtection
今天我们来了解有关Secret加密以及Configmapd配置介绍一、Configmapd配置介绍ConfigMap功能在Kubernetes1.2版本中引入,许多应用程序会从配置文件、命令行参数或环境变量中读取配置信息。ConfigMapAPI给我们提供了向容器中注入配置信息的机制,ConfigMap可以被用来保存单个属性,也可以用来保存整个配置文件或者JSON二进制大对象。将配置信息放到configmap对象中,然后在pod的对象中导入configmap对象,实现导入配置的操作。ConigMap是一种API对象,用来将非机密性的数据保存到键值对中。使用时可以用作环境变量、命令行参数或者存
我将编写自己的加密,但希望讨论一些内部知识。应该在多个移动平台上使用-iOS,Android,WP7,其中或多或少将台式机用作测试平台。让我们首先从现有解决方案的简要特征入手:SQLite标准(商业)SEE扩展-我不知道它在内部如何工作以及如何与提到的移动平台协作。System.data.sqlite(仅Windows):完整的DB,ECB模式的RC4加密。他们还会加密数据库头,偶尔(0.01%的机会)会导致数据库损坏。*)额外的优势:他们使用SQLite合并分发。SqlCipher(openssl,即多个平台):可选的加密方案。他们加密整个数据库。CBC模式(我认为),随机IV向量。